For the weekly eng sync: we identified configuration drift between the Meridly sync workers in the Holtsford and Braywick regions. Holtsford workers were updated to the new conflict-resolution policy (last-writer-wins with tombstone checks), while Braywick still runs the legacy merge behavior. The result is duplicate and ghost events for tenants whose calendars replicate across both regions. Remediation is to re-pin Braywick to the shared baseline and redeploy. The baseline configuration that both regions should converge on is shown below.

settings of yadup-tajef:
[pelys]
team = raleth
access_code = ac_67f5a1
host = pelys.olvarqlabs.local
port = 8080
owner = pramir.pramir
peer = rusir.qirvanio.corp

### Q3 Planning Note — Heads of Department

Quick update on the Lanternfish pilot at Medway Softworks: churn came in higher than we'd like, around 22% by week six. Most drop-offs happened right after the trial-to-paid step, so that's where we'll focus. Priya's team is reworking pricing prompts, and Support is adding a check-in call at day ten. Budget stays flat for now. There's one strategic point you should all be aware of.

confidential, bahof-yaweg: Headcount on the Kaseth team goes from 32 to 109 by the end of January. Gross margin on Kaseth came in at 46 percent against a plan of 45 percent.

**Vendor note: Inkmill markdown pipeline**

Rendering for Parchway docs is outsourced to Inkmill under an annual contract, renewing each March. They handle sanitization and PDF export; we own the upload queue. SLA: 4-hour response on rendering failures. Escalate only after two failed retries. Their support desk is reachable at the address below.

billing contact of hahaf-baguf = zorael.tammir.jorius@sivrelhq.internal